PM emphasizes on global effort to repatriate Rohingyas

Bangladesh Live News | @banglalivenews | 29 Jan 2024, 12:02 pm

Dhaka, Jan 29: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ina urged the international community to repatriate the Rohingyas to their homeland Myanmar and take measures to ensure their dignified life there.

She said, "The world should find a way to solve the Rohingya crisis, so that they can go back to their homeland and live a good life there."

She said this during a courtesy meeting with a UK cross-party parliamentary delegation led by Birendra Sharma MP, Vice Chair of the All-Party Parliamentary Group on Bangladesh Affairs (APPG) and Chair of the APPG on Indo-British Affairs, at Ganabhaban on Sunday. After the meeting, Prime Minister's speechwriter M. Nazrul Islam briefed the journalists.

This is the first visit of the UK parliamentary party after the general election was held in Bangladesh on January 7. During the meeting, Sheikh Hasina said that Bangladesh had given shelter to the Rohingyas in 2017 after their mass exodus in the face of inhuman torture.

The Prime Minister also said that although Myanmar has agreed to take back its citizens, no action has been taken to this end despite the passage of six years. The delegation is scheduled to leave for London on January 31.
